Resin repairs

One of the most common auto glass problems is a chip or crack. Most of these issues can be corrected. Certain damage might need to be repaired.

Repairing auto glass repair door is fast and simple. A professional will know how clean and prepare damaged areas before they can fix them. They can also use high quality resin to help make the repair last.

You can purchase glass repair kits from a hardware store or at a DIY shop in case you're a DIYer. These kits typically come with all the tools and supplies needed to complete the minor repair.

There are various kinds of resins that are used in this kind of repair. You will need to choose the most suitable one for your glass. In general, epoxy is a good choice because it is durable and durable.

A specialized UV lamp can be purchased if want to create an outstanding repair. This light helps cure the resin more quickly. It is not recommended to expose the resin to sunlight or the rain as it might cause it to turn discolored.

You should also consider using curing strips. They are available in a variety of sizes and are designed to keep the resin in its spot while it cures. The strip is used to prevent the resin from leaching out of cracks.

Another method to fix a broken chip is to use a bullseye tapping device. This tool helps you remove tiny glass shards that can cause damage to the glass in the first place.

The most important aspect of windshield repair is usually cleaning. While it could be tempting to skip this step however, it increases the chance of cracks becoming more extensive.

Security film

Security films are a great method to shield your home from burglary. It not only enhances the security of your windows, but also adds an extra layer of insulation to your home.

Security films are available in various sizes and thicknesses. They are generally made from a heavy gauge plastic. They feature a patented adhesive that forms a molecular bond between the frame and glass.

It is the thing that holds the glass together after it has broken. Criminals will find it much harder to break the glass.

Security films that are more efficient than standard windows are thicker. They can reach up to 400 micrometers thick. They are more expensive due to the fact that they require more material.

The best type of security film is one that gives the greatest benefits for the least amount of money. Certain films provide a mirrored view from the outside as well as a subtly tinted, one-way view from inside.

Loctite Super Glue Glass

If you're trying to fix damaged or cracked pieces of glass, or are looking to bond two pieces of glass together, Loctite Super Glue is your best choice. It's easy to use, it's clear and is dishwasher-safe.

It's also an excellent glue to repair damaged or broken mirrors and glass chandeliers. It glues to plastic, metal ceramic, wood and even ceramic as well as stone and glass.

It is essential to choose the glue that is resistant to extreme weather conditions if you are planning to use it outdoors. The glue must be also resistant to moisture. It is more effective to use silicone-based adhesives over epoxy in wet environments.

If you're looking to repair residential glass window repair cookware, you'll require glue that is able to withstand high temperatures. This can be a problem. You might want to look into the Gorilla super glue gel cap, which was designed for crystal clear glass. However, the gel can cause a cloudy effect.

There are many different kinds of glass glue available. In addition to silicone and epoxy you can also get special glass glue and liquid. They are specifically designed to join the unique properties of glass.

You should also take into consideration the time it takes for the glue to dry when searching for glass panel repair repair glue. Some glues will dry in minutes, while others require a few weeks or more. Generally, a fast-drying glue is ideal for small repairs, whereas the slower drying glue is best for larger projects.

Before beginning your glass repair project, it's important to wash the glass surface. A combination of rubbing alcohol and water is a great method to get rid of dirt and oil. It is recommended to use latex or Nitrile gloves to protect your hands.
